A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| X | Y | Z | AA | AB | AC | AD | AE | AF | AG | AH | AI | AJ | AK | AL | AM | AN | AO | AP | AQ | AR | AS | AT | AU | AV | AW | AX | AY | AZ | BA | BB | BC | BD | BE | BF | BG | BH | BI | BJ | BK | BL | BM | |
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
1 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
2 | 職 務 経 歴 書 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
3 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
4 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
5 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
6 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
7 | 氏名 | 福田玄登 | 性 別 | 男 | 年 齢 | 24歳 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
8 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
9 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
10 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
11 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
12 | 得意分野 | Ionic、Flutterを使ったハイブリッドアプリ開発と、Angular、Vueなどを使ったWebフロントエンド Firebaseを使ったBaaSの開発と運用 その他については自己紹介サイトを参照 https://mypage-93215.web.app/ |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
13 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
14 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
15 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
16 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
17 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
18 | 期 間 | 業界 (業種) | 契約 形態 | 業 務 内 容 | 担 当 工 程 | 環境・言語 等 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
19 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
20 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
21 | 2020/10 | ~ | 現在 | 個人開発 | ー | ■【PJ詳細】 TMDB APIを使った映画好きのためのプラットフォーム 自分の「好きな作品」を記録し、自分と好みが似ているユーザーの「好きな作品」を見ることができる。 ■【言語・フレームワーク】 ・Nuxt.js(Vuex, VueRouter, Vuetify) ・Firebase(認証、DB、ストレージ) ・HTML/CSS ・Flutter(モバイルアプリ向け) ■【作業内容】 - 映画の情報を取得できるTMDB APIを研究し、Nuxt.jsで実装 - Firebaseでユーザーの認証、データベース、ストレージを用意 ■【習得技術】 ・Nuxt.jsを使ったSPAの知識とスキル ・Flutterを使ったモバイルアプリ開発の知識とスキル ・FlutterでFirebase + Providerを使った状態管理に関する知識とスキル ■【リンク】 ※現在Web側とアプリ側を並行して開発途中 https://konomiru-1f37c.web.app/ | 実装/テスト | ■OS Mac OS Big Sur ■DB Cloud Firestore ■言語 Nuxt.js(Javascriot) HTML5 / CSS3 Flutter(Dart) ■ツール等 Git npm VSCode Vuetify Vuex Vuerouter Provider(Flutter) ■Firebase Cloud Firestore, Authentication, Cloud Storage |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||
22 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
23 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
24 | 2名規模 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
25 | 2020/9 | ~ | 現在 | Web モバイルアプリ | 正社員 | ■【PJ詳細】 不動産事業者、エンドユーザー、金融機関の3者間チャットで、住宅ローン業務を効率化。 また、アプリのOEM版も開発し展開。 ■【PJ規模】 OEM版を展開しており、5社以上の会社が導入。 全てのアプリをトータルすると、エンドユーザーは数千人の規模。 ■【言語・フレームワーク】 ・UIフレームワークでOnsen UI ・JavascriptフレームワークでVue.js ・phpフレームワークでLaravel ・ネイティブアプリとしてビルドするためにCordovaとMonaca ■【作業内容】 - Vue.jsによるフロントエンドの新規開発 - php/LaravelによるWeb APIの開発 - Cordovaでネイティブアプリ用のプラグインを導入 - 運用保守としての不具合の修正と、アップデートとリリース - アプリストア用の画像やアイコンの作成 - 複数人でのソースレビュー ■【習得技術】 ・Vue/Vuexを使ったSPAの知識とスキル ・Laravelの知識とスキル ・Cordovaに関する知識 ・DockerとOpen API (Swagger)を使った環境構築 ・Git/Githubを使ったバージョン管理、pull request、mergeなどの概念と操作方法 ・App StoreとGoogle Play Storeでのリジェクト、ポリシー違反などに関する知識 ■【アプリ情報】 https://dandori.iyell.jp | 実装/テスト | ■OS Mac OS Big Sur ■DB MySQL ■言語 Vue.js 2系(Javascript) Laravel(php) SCSS HTML5 / CSS3 ■ツール等 Docker Open API (Swagger) Git npm VSCode MySql Workbench Xcode Android Studio Monaca ■Firebase Cloud Messaging ■その他 Backlog Chatwork G Suite |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||
26 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
27 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
28 | 6名規模 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
29 | 2019/7 | ~ | 現在 | 個人開発 | ■【PJ詳細】 公式ドキュメントとYoutubeとネット検索を駆使して、独学で開発。 カレンダーを使った性活管理アプリの開発。 ■【PJ規模】 現在、iOSとAndroidの合計で約3000人のユーザーがいる。 月500円程の収益あり。 ■【言語・フレームワーク】 ・UIフレームワークでIonic ・JavascriptフレームワークでAngular ・Firebase ・ネイティブアプリとしてビルドするためにCapacitor ■【作業内容】 - IonicとAngularによるフロントエンドの開発 - カレンダーのライブラリを改造 - Firebaseでユーザーの認証とデータベースを用意 - Capacitorでネイティブアプリ用のプラグインを導入 - アプリストア用の画像やアイコンを用意 ■【習得技術】 ・各ストアでアプリを公開する為の知識 ・AngularでSPAフレームワークの概念を理解 ・Capacitorでネイティブの機能(端末のストレージなど)へアクセスする方法 ・Firebaseを使った認証、匿名認証、プッシュ通知、Cloud Functionsなどを実装 ・オブジェクト指向開発の理解 ・iOSとAndroidの開発環境の知識 ・広告で収益化する方法 ・IonicのSlackグループ、stackoverflow(英語)などで質問する際の言語化スキル ・ユーザーとコミュニケーションを取る手段 ■【アプリ情報】 https://hcalendar-7c1f4.web.app | 実装/テスト | ■OS Mac OS Mojave ■DB Cloud Firestore ■言語 Angular(Typescript) SCSS HTML5 / CSS3 ■ツール等 git Ionic 5 VSCode Xcode Android Studio ■Firebase Cloud Firestore, Authentication, Cloud Functions, Cloud Messaging |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
30 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
31 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
32 | 2020/3 | ~ | 2020/05 | Web | 請負 | ■【PJ詳細】 アパレル会社のWebサイトリニューアルと、商品の検索機能を開発。 ■【PJ規模】 ページ数が50以上と多く、SEOにも影響を与えないようサイトの階層をデザイン。 ■【作業内容】 - 本番環境からエクスポートしてxmlファイルを元に、Localに開発環境を構築 - デザイナーさんが作ったXDをもとに、HTML/CSSでコーディング - Wordpressのテーマに適応させる - PHPでCSVファイルから商品を検索する - AWS S3で画像を取得 - レスポンシブデザイン対応 ■【習得技術】 ・jQueryに関するスキル ・Wordpressでオリジナルテーマを作る知識 | 開発/テスト | ■OS Mac OS Mojave ■言語 PHP JavaScript(jQuery) HTML5 / CSS3 ■ツール等 Sublime Text Local Wordpress Slack Trello ■AWS S3 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||
33 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
34 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
35 | 2名規模 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
36 | 2019/12 | ~ | 2020/1 | Web | 請負 | ■【PJ詳細】 Google Apps Scriptを使ったGoogleスプレッドシートの業務効率化。 見積書から請求書を自動生成し、指定フォルダにPDFファイルにとして書き出す。 ■【PJ規模】 一人で開発 ■【作業内容】 - 見積書と請求書のテンプレをGoogle スプレッドシートで作成 - スクリプトエディタにコードを書いて実装 ■【習得技術】 ・Google Apps Scriptに関するスキル ・Googleスプレッドシートの使い方 ■【コード】 https://qiita.com/kokogento/items/420b80924c36e2674d5b | 開発/テスト | ■OS Mac OS Mojave ■言語 Google Apps Script ■ツール等 Googleスプレッドシート |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||
37 | 1名 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
38 | 2018/2 | 2018/4 | 個人開発 | ■【PJ詳細】 Googleマップに動画を埋め込むWebサービス。プライベートで風景の動画をYoutubeにアップしており、その動画を地図上に配置するために開発。 Googleアカウントでログインすれば、誰でも動画を配置できる。 PWAを実装。 ■【言語・ツール】 - PHP - HTML/CSS - JavaScript(jQuery) - Heroku - Firebase - MySql ■【習得技術】 ・Herokuを使ったWebサービスをデプロイする方法 ・Google Map APIやGoogleアカウントでのログインなど、GCP周りの知識と ・DB設計、SQLについての知識 ・WebアプリをPWAにする方法 ■【リンク】 https://www.wheview.net/ | 開発/テスト | ■言語 PHP JavaScript(jQuery) HTML5 / CSS3 ■ツール等 Sublime Text GCP - Google Map API - Firebase authentication Heroku ■データベース MySql |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
39 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
40 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
41 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
42 | プログラミングの記録 | 【Qiita】 https://qiita.com/kokogento 【Github】 https://github.com/gentixyann |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
43 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
44 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
45 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
46 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
47 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
48 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
49 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
50 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
51 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
52 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
53 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
54 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
55 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
56 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
57 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
58 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
59 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
60 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
61 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
62 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
63 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
64 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
65 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
66 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
67 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
68 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
69 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
70 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
71 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
72 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
73 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
74 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
75 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
76 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
77 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
78 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
79 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
80 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
81 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
82 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
83 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
84 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
85 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
86 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
87 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
88 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
89 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
90 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
91 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
92 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
93 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
94 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
95 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
96 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
97 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
98 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
99 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
100 |